Book description

Bones Will Crow is the first anthology of contemporary Burmese poets in any language, and includes the work of Burmese poets in exile, in prison and undercover. Introduced by Zeyar Lynn, with a Preface by Ruth Padel.

The poets featured are Tin Moe (1933-2007), Thitsar Ni (b. 1946), Aung Cheimt (b. 1948), Ma Ei (b. 1948), Maung Chaw Nwe (1949-2002), Maung Pyiyt Min (b. 1953), Khin Aung Aye (b. 1956), Zeyar Lynn (b. 1958), Maung Thein Zaw (b. 1959), Moe Zaw (b. 1964), Moe Way (b. 1969), Ko Ko Thett (b. 1972), Eaindra (b. 1973), Pandora (b. 1974) and Maung Yu Py (b. 1981).
